Peer reviewedMatolyak, J.; And Others – Physics Teacher, 1983
Describes equipment and procedures for an experiment using diodes to introduce non-linear electronic devices in a freshman physics laboratory. The experiment involves calculation and plotting of the characteristic-curve and load-line to predict the operating point and compare prediction to experimentally determined values. Peer reviewedMinnix, Richard B.; Carpenter, D. Rae, Jr. – Physics Teacher, 1983
Describes a simple apparatus and provides instructions to do relative index of refraction measurements/calculations and to show mathematical relationships betwen indices when light travels from one liquid to another. A listing of a computer program (in BASIC) which will analyze data is available from the author. (JM)

Peer reviewedKing, D. J. – Mercury, 1983
The application of very sensitive electronic detecting devices during the last decade has revolutionized and revitalized the study of polarization in celestial objects. The nature of polarization, how polaroids work, interstellar polarization, dichroic filters, polarization by scattering, and modern polarimetry are among the topics discussed. (JN)

Peer reviewedIona, Mario – Physics Teacher, 1983
Many secondary/college textbook authors define current explicitly or implicitly, by the diagrams, in terms of negative-charge motion. Discusses several reasons why the "conventional current" direction is preferred. (JN)

Peer reviewedCrane, H. Richard, Ed. – Physics Teacher, 1983
Discusses the physics of liquid crystal displays (LCD) which is based on polarizing properties of crystals controlled by electric command. Production of alphanumerics, display control, and input are considered. (JM)

Peer reviewedKruglak, Haym – Physics Teacher, 1983
Describes the construction of a small (portable), inexpensive, and easy to build Foucault pendulum. Includes photographs of the apparatus, a schematic of the electrical circuit used, and discussion of the amount of accuracy to be expected during classroom investigation. (JM)

Peer reviewedGraef, Jean L. – Science Teacher, 1983
Four ways in which microcomputers can be turned into laboratory instruments are discussed. These include adding an analog/digital (A/D) converter on a printed circuit board, adding an external A/D converter using the computer's serial port, attaching transducers to the game paddle ports, or connecting an instrument to the computer. Peer reviewedJournal of Chemical Education, 1983
Highlights six papers presented at the Seventh Biennial Conference on Chemical Education (Stillwater, Oklahoma 1982). Topics addressed included history, status, and future of SI units, algebra of SI units, periodic table, new standard-state pressure unit, and suggested new names for mole concept ("numerity" and "chemical amount").
